About Beacon Fell

Beacon Fell is a mountain summit in the Ingleborough to Blackpool region in the county of Lancashire, England. Beacon Fell is 266 metres high with a prominence of 93 metres. The summit can be identified by: trig point with viewfinder Additional Notes: All the walks up Beacon Fell on Mud and Routes can be seen above.

Beacon Fell Summit Stats

Height in Metres: 266 metres

Height in Feet: 873 feet

Range: Forest of Bowland

Prominence: 93 metres

Parent Summit: Fair Snape Fell

Grid Reference: SD568428

Col Height: 173

Col Grid Reference: SD584430

Summit Classification: sHu, 2

National Park, County or Country: England’s Highest Mountains, Forest of Bowland, Lancashire

Recommended Maps: Landranger Map 102   Explorer Map OL41W
